Output f89f78daefe76d07d6608bb42edc1a558b8711a35ec609fd3fd60ebc3ccc7ac1:9

value
21040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ab76b9a36cd1e140fe65bd9b2b17223a7067bfe4 OP_EQUAL
address
3HKdhWp1H2ZdfA9GP6fCQx9QZDBwLHezrv
transaction
f89f78daefe76d07d6608bb42edc1a558b8711a35ec609fd3fd60ebc3ccc7ac1
spent
true